摘要

Ridge-waveguide laser diodes emitting near 2.38 Μm have beennfabricated from GaInAsSb-GaSb type-II quantum-well (QW) structures grownnby molecular beam epitaxy. These devices operated continuous-wave (CW)nat room temperature, what is obtained for the first time from a type-IInQW laser. At 23°C threshold currents in the range 60-140 mA and CWnoutput powers exceeding 1 mW/facet were obtained. These lasers showed antendency to operate in a single longitudinal mode with a temperature rednshift of 0.1 nm/°C and a current red shift of 0.06 nm/mA
